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

Cet article présente une cartographie du champ des études critiques sur les données (critical data studies). Il retrace son émergence au sein de la littérature anglophone et francophone et précise sa perspective sur le plan épistémologique autour de la constitution d’un objet de recherche propre, la « donnée ». Il organise les travaux rassemblés dans ce champ de recherche autour de deux axes thématiques : l’étude des conséquences de la mise en données sur la vie sociale et l’étude des solutions de remplacement à la datafication.
